Navigating car troubles can be stressful, especially when that pesky check engine light illuminates on your dashboard. For owners of a 2009 Hyundai Elantra, understanding what your car’s On-Board Diagnostic (OBD2) system is trying to tell you is the first step towards effective troubleshooting. This article will delve into the world of OBD2 codes, focusing specifically on how they relate to fuel level issues in your 2009 Hyundai Elantra.
Understanding OBD-II and Your 2009 Hyundai Elantra
The OBD-II system is essentially your car’s self-diagnostic and reporting system. Since the mid-1990s, OBD-II has been standardized across most vehicles, including your 2009 Hyundai Elantra. It monitors various systems within your car, from the engine and transmission to emissions control, and yes, even your fuel system. When the system detects a problem outside of normal parameters, it triggers a “check engine light” and stores a Diagnostic Trouble Code (DTC).
These DTCs are your car’s way of communicating the nature of the problem. Mechanics and car owners alike can use an OBD-II scanner to retrieve these codes and begin the diagnostic process. While a code itself doesn’t pinpoint the exact faulty part, it significantly narrows down the potential problem area, saving time and effort in repairs.
Fuel Level Sensors and OBD2 Codes: What’s the Connection?
While there isn’t a specific OBD2 code solely dedicated to “fuel level,” issues with your 2009 Hyundai Elantra’s fuel level sensor or related components can indeed trigger OBD2 codes and illuminate the check engine light. The fuel level sensor is crucial for providing accurate readings to your car’s computer (PCM or Powertrain Control Module), which in turn uses this information for fuel injection calculations and dashboard gauge readings.
Problems can arise from a faulty fuel level sensor, wiring issues, or even problems within the PCM itself. These issues might not directly display as a “fuel level sensor code” but can manifest as codes related to:
- Lean or Rich Fuel Conditions (P0171, P0174): If the fuel level sensor is providing incorrect readings, the car’s computer might miscalculate the fuel-air mixture, leading to lean (too much air) or rich (too much fuel) conditions.
- Evaporative Emission Control System (EVAP) leaks (P0440, P0441, P0442, P0455): While seemingly unrelated, the EVAP system is connected to the fuel tank. Issues within the fuel tank area, potentially including sensor malfunctions or related wiring, could trigger EVAP system codes.
- Fuel Injector Circuit Malfunctions (P0200-P0205): Although less directly related to the fuel level sensor, fuel delivery problems stemming from inaccurate fuel level readings could theoretically lead to injector circuit codes in some scenarios.
Keep in mind that these are just potential connections, and a proper diagnosis is always necessary. Let’s look at a broader range of OBD-II codes that might appear in your 2009 Hyundai Elantra, based on general Hyundai OBD-II data.
Common OBD-II Trouble Codes for Hyundai Elantra (and Potential Fuel Level Links)
Here is a table of common OBD-II codes and potential problems, similar to the original article, but with added context and potential links to fuel system or fuel level related issues where applicable for a 2009 Hyundai Elantra. Remember, this is not exhaustive, and professional diagnosis is always recommended.
Code | Common Problems That Trigger This Code | Potential Fuel Level Sensor/System Link? |
---|---|---|
P0011, P0012, P0014 | Camshaft variable timing solenoid failure, Engine oil level is too low, Incorrect engine timing, Incorrect engine oil, Variable valve timing actuator failure, Worn timing chain | No direct link, but engine performance issues can sometimes indirectly affect fuel consumption readings. |
P0101, P0102 | Mass Airflow Sensor (MAF) issues (Leaks, sensor malfunction, wiring) | Lean/Rich fuel conditions possible if MAF readings are skewed, potentially misinterpreting fuel needs. |
P0113 | Intake Air Temperature Sensor issues | Indirectly affects fuel calculations; inaccurate temperature readings can impact fuel-air mixture. |
P0128 | Thermostat or Coolant Temperature Sensor issues, Cooling System problems | Engine temperature affects fuel efficiency and sensor readings. |
P0135 | Oxygen Sensor/Air Fuel Ratio Sensor Heater Circuit issues, Exhaust/Intake leaks, Low Fuel Pressure | Low fuel pressure could be related to fuel delivery issues, but less likely directly to fuel level sensor. O2 sensor readings are directly affected by fuel-air mixture. |
P0171, P0174 | System Too Lean (Bank 1 & 2) – Vacuum leaks, MAF sensor, Fuel Filter/Pump, Injectors | YES – Potential Link: A faulty fuel level sensor could contribute to incorrect fuel calculations leading to lean conditions, although other causes are more common. |
P0200-P0205 | Fuel Injector Circuit Malfunctions (Specific Cylinders) | Indirect Link Possible: In severe cases of fuel system misdiagnosis due to sensor issues, injector problems could theoretically arise, though less likely a direct cause. |
P0300-P0304 | Random/Multiple Cylinder Misfire | Low fuel pressure, fuel delivery issues can cause misfires. |
P0440, P0441, P0442, P0455 | EVAP System Leaks (various severity) – Fuel cap, hoses, canister, valves, tank leaks | YES – Potential Link: EVAP system is connected to the fuel tank. Issues in the fuel tank area or related components could trigger these codes, though primarily leak-related. |
P0420, P0430 | Catalytic Converter Efficiency Below Threshold | Misfires or rich fuel conditions (potentially from miscalculated fuel delivery) can damage the catalytic converter over time. |
P0401 | EGR System Flow Insufficient | EGR system affects emissions, indirectly linked to engine efficiency and potentially fuel management. |
P0500, P0501 | Vehicle Speed Sensor Issues | No direct fuel level link. |
P0505, P0506, P0507 | Idle Air Control System Issues | Idle control and air intake are related to engine operation and can indirectly affect fuel consumption and sensor readings. |
P0600, P0601, P0602, P0603, P0605 | PCM (Powertrain Control Module) Malfunctions | YES – Potential Link: The PCM is the brain controlling fuel calculations. A PCM issue could misinterpret fuel level sensor data or cause related malfunctions. However, PCM failure is less common than sensor or wiring issues. |
P0700, P0705, P0706, P0720, P0730, P0841, P0842, P0845, P0846, P0847, P0901, P0935, P0942, P0944, P0961 | Transmission Related Codes | No direct fuel level link. |
P0A08, P0A0D, P0A0F, P0A7F, P0A80, P0B22, P0B24, P0B26, P0B28, P0B30, P0C00, P0C09, P0C11, P0C14, P0C15, P2000, P2002, P2004, P2006, P2101, P2122, P2135, P2138, P2181, P2210, P2213, P2237, P2238, P2251, P2302, P2303, P2305, P2308, P2310, P2401, P2402, P2422, P2431, P2432, P2500, P2501, P2503, P2509, P250C, P2601, P2607, P2609, P2610, P2614, P2706, P2711, P2714, P2716, P2723, P2803, P2806, P2809, P2810, P2815, P2A00, P2A01, P2A03, P2A04, P2BA8, P3000, P3100, P3400, P3401, B0081, C0040, U0001, U0073, U0100, U0107, U0121 | Various Other System Codes | No direct fuel level link in most cases, unless indirectly impacting engine performance and potentially fuel calculations in very specific scenarios (less likely). |
Using an OBD2 Scanner to Check Your 2009 Hyundai Elantra Fuel Level System
An OBD2 scanner is an invaluable tool for any car owner. Here’s how you can use it to investigate potential fuel level related issues in your 2009 Hyundai Elantra:
- Locate the OBD2 Port: In a 2009 Hyundai Elantra, it’s typically located under the dashboard on the driver’s side.
- Plug in the Scanner: Turn your car’s ignition to the “ON” position (don’t start the engine), and plug the scanner into the OBD2 port.
- Read Codes: Follow your scanner’s instructions to read any stored trouble codes. Note down all codes present.
- Research Codes: Use resources like this article or online OBD2 code databases to understand what each code signifies. Pay attention to codes potentially related to fuel delivery, lean/rich conditions, or EVAP systems.
- Clear Codes (Optional and with Caution): Some scanners allow you to clear codes. Only do this if you understand the codes and want to see if the issue returns. Clearing codes without diagnosing the problem is generally not recommended. The check engine light might come back on immediately if the underlying issue persists, and clearing codes can sometimes erase valuable diagnostic information.
When to Seek Professional Help for Your Hyundai Elantra
While an OBD2 scanner provides valuable clues, it’s not a substitute for professional diagnosis, especially when dealing with potentially complex systems like fuel delivery and engine management.
You should seek professional service if:
- You are uncomfortable diagnosing or repairing car issues yourself.
- The OBD2 scanner reveals multiple codes or codes you don’t understand.
- You suspect a fuel level sensor issue but are unsure how to test or replace it.
- The check engine light returns quickly after clearing codes.
- Your car is experiencing drivability problems alongside the check engine light.
Certified Hyundai technicians have specialized training and equipment to accurately diagnose and repair your 2009 Hyundai Elantra. They can perform in-depth system testing, including fuel system analysis, sensor testing, and wiring checks, to pinpoint the root cause of the problem and ensure a correct and lasting repair.
Don’t let a check engine light and confusing OBD2 codes leave you stranded. Understanding the basics and knowing when to seek expert help will keep your 2009 Hyundai Elantra running smoothly and efficiently.